The UN General Assembly will be in session on Monday, and that means lots of motorcades, road closures, security - and gridlock.

FDR Drive between Whitehall Street and 42nd Street

Area Bounded by 60th Street on the North, 34th Street on the South, 1st Avenue on the East and 3rd Avenue on the West; All inclusive Area bounded by 54th Street on the North, 48th Street on the South, 1st Avenue on the East and Madison Avenue on the West; All inclusive5th Avenue between East 55th Street and East 50th StreetGrand Army Plaza between East Drive and 5th AvenuePark Avenue between East 62nd Street and East 42nd StreetLexington Avenue between East 57th Street and East 42nd StreetEast 63rd Street between 5th Avenue and Madison AvenueEast 61st Street between 5th Avenue and Lexington AvenueWest/East 58th Street...
